My Ark Poem by Federico del Corazón

My Ark



If I could build an Ark

To be consumed with a lovers heart
To be true in my pure form

A question for you
What would you put in your Ark

Would you put the worlds love in it
Celebrating every single joy

Would you fill it with a poet’s song
Would you hear the laughter
of children at play

What would you carry in your Ark

Would it be big enough to fit
The Sun, Moon and Venus

My Ark is my heart
You have my world

Be kind to me
